Man dies, 4 others hurt after Mercedes crashes through railing at Tampines junction
SINGAPORE - A 59-year-old man died after an accident late on Thursday (Dec 23) night at the junction of Tampines Avenue 1 and Tampines Avenue 10. Four others were injured.
Footage circulating online showed a red Mercedes crashing through a railing at a traffic light. The accident involved four cars, a taxi and a motorcycle.
Police said they were alerted to the accident at about 11.10pm. The 59-year-old male driver, who was in one of the vehicles hit by the Mercedes, was unconscious and taken to the hospital, where he later died from his injuries.
